A detailed nutritional comparison
Bread provides more protein and carbohydrates, making it a better option for quick energy and satiety. Berries are low in calories and high in fiber, vitamins, and antioxidants, offering superior nutrient density and benefits for overall health. Bread works well for energy-demanding activities, while berries are great for snacking and improving dietary nutrient intake.

Bread contains 6x more protein than berries per serving.
Berries contain 4x more fiber, supporting digestion and satiety.
Berries are 37.5% lower in calories per serving.
Berries provide significantly higher levels of Vitamin C and antioxidants.

Choose bread if you need quick energy or higher protein content, such as before workouts or as a base for meals. Opt for berries if you're looking for a nutrient-dense, low-calorie snack or want to increase antioxidant and fiber intake.
